Each Vic club’s biggest home crowd against GC.

Carlton = 39,597 (2024)
Richmond = 38,508 (2015)
Collingwood = 36,913 (2012)
Essendon = 33,710 (2011)
Hawthorn = 31,331 (2019)
Geelong = 30,087 (2013)
Melbourne = 27,013 (2015)
Western Bulldogs = 22,499 (2019)
St Kilda = 21,078 (2012)
North Melbourne = 19,819 (2014)
